About The Position

A BIM Technician III takes a lead role in providing advanced technical expertise and support in the development and coordination of complex 3D models for engineering projects. This position requires a deep understanding of BIM processes, software and expertise in troubleshooting to ensure the seamless and successful execution of projects.

Responsibilities

  • Prepares layouts, details, schedules, drawings and other documents of mechanical, plumbing, fire protection, refrigeration, technology and/or electrical systems.
  • Creates project BIM Execution Plans (BEPs) to incorporate project requirements and standards.
  • Implements complex BEP objectives and guidelines into the BIM workflow and communicates BEP-related information effectively to project team.
  • Creates and maintains documentation related to BIM processes, workflows and standards for the project.
  • Leads development of project BEP development for the architect.
  • Performs or directs model setup tasks including but not limited to base cleaning, sheet setup and view setup.
  • Ensures that BIM models adhere to established industry and organizational standards.
  • Performs or directs routine model maintenance tasks to ensure accuracy and integrity of 3D models and associated data.
  • Prepares or reviews regular reports of BIM models of complex projects or programs to assess their health, integrity and compliance with project standards.
  • Identifies and addresses issues affecting model health and collaborates with the project team to implement necessary improvements.
  • Generates clash reports to identify clashes within BIM models.
  • Utilizes clash detection tools and collaborates with project teams to address clashes effectively.
  • Calculates quantities and performs engineering related computations.
  • Provides advanced support and troubleshooting to designers regarding BIM software errors.
  • Escalates more complex issues as needed.
  • Creates advanced families and schedules to support project requirements.
  • Contributes to the development and maintenance of organization-specific BIM standards.
  • Develops complex scripts and automation tools to enhance BIM workflows.
  • Maintains knowledge and expertise in various BIM software applications including their latest features and updates.
  • Assesses and recommends new software tools and technologies that could improve BIM workflows.
